    Smile TD5 Fuel Filter Water Sensor problem

    Hi To All,
    Just wanted to share a little bit of information re the water sensor located at the bottom of the fuel filter. After just changing the fuel filter I started her up and found the water light was on all the time. Did a little investigating and found the fault was due to the sensor tip touching a metal section located inside the filter. This appears to only effect the Bearmach ESR4686R (Also labelled ESR4686 <C>) filters and is due to the internal construction of the filter. The original and Britpart filters are not a problem.

    Fuel filter td5

    This is also a problem with ryco and other filters I contactad Land Rover they said disconect it as we have had a lot of problems with these's so I rang my machanic he told me the same as they only deal with Land Rover I disconected it problem solved.
